"Effortless Remote Support with Minor Mac Glitches"
What do you like best about ISL Online?

I like that ISL Online is quick, easy to use, and can be installed on almost every system. I have used it on mobile phones, Macs, and Windows, and it's been incredibly useful in every scenario. I appreciate being able to demonstrate to customers how to use software or processes, and enjoy being able to resolve issues expediently while letting customers relax. The support from the ISL Online team was much better than I experienced with previous products, and their assistance made our migration easy. The initial setup was always smooth with scripted installations, allowing us to inject passwords and group setups efficiently, ensuring we knew exactly where everything was in our list of computers.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about ISL Online?

Sometimes the connections to Mac systems are glitchy. They have to be reconnected once or twice. But once completed, the connection is stable and ready to use.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

"ISLOnline a tool that helps manage"
What do you like best about ISL Online?

ISL Online is a robust and reliable remote access and technical support solution, designed for companies that require secure, stable, and efficient connectivity with remote equipment and users. The platform allows for technical assistance, unattended access, file transfer, real-time chat, and remote control, all from an intuitive and easy-to-use interface.

One of the main differentiators of ISL Online is its high focus on security, incorporating end-to-end encryption, multi-factor authentication, access control, and compliance with international standards, making it a suitable option for corporate environments and organizations with strict security policies.

Additionally, ISL Online stands out for its implementation flexibility, as it can be used both in the cloud and on-premise, adapting to different operational and regulatory needs. Its licensing model, based on concurrent technicians and not by the number of devices, is cost-effective and scalable for growing companies.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about ISL Online?

Some advanced features of ISL Online may be less intuitive for new users or staff without technical experience. This may require a period of adaptation and training, especially in companies where several technicians need to use the tool quickly.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

"Simple, Reliable Remote Access—Easy for Older Users to Set Up"
What do you like best about ISL Online?

It’s simple to use and it just works. I work with a lot of older people, and ISLOnline is much easier for them to set up than most other tools.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about ISL Online?

It’s not really a dislike, but I do wish it offered a way to access the backend. For example, being able to get to the task manager or view the processes that are running without having to take control of the screen. Sometimes a client just needs me to stop a process, and being able to do that behind the scenes would be a big benefit.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.
